How Electronic Logging Devices and Telematics Data Expose Negligence in the Trucking Industry
In the trucking industry, electronic logging devices (ELDs) and telematics data have become invaluable tools for monitoring driver behavior and exposing potential negligence. ELDs and telematics data provide detailed insights into a truck driver's activities, including driving hours, speeding, sudden braking, and other critical factors that can contribute to accidents. By analyzing this data, our team of experienced personal injury lawyers can uncover patterns of negligence, such as drivers exceeding the legal limit for hours of service or engaging in reckless driving behaviors.
When a trucking accident occurs, the information gathered from ELDs and telematics can be crucial in building a strong case.
